1Simultaneous optimization of multiple performance characteristics in WEDM for machining ZC63/SiC_p MMC显示文摘The compliance of an integrated approach, principal component analysis(PCA),coupled with Taguchi's robust theory for simultaneous optimization of correlated multiple responses of wire electrical discharge machining(WEDM) process for machining SiC_P reinforced ZC63 metal matrix composites(MMCs) is investigated in this work.The WEDM is proven better for its efficiency to machine MMCs among others,while the particulate size and volume percentage of SiC_p with the composite are the utmost important factors.These improve the mechanical properties enormously,however reduce the machining performance.Hence the WEDM experiments are conducted by varying the particulate size,volume fraction,pulse-on time,pulse-off time and wire tension.In the view of quality cut,the most important performance indicators of WEDM as surface roughness(R_a),metal removal rate(MRR),wire wear ratio(WWR),kerf(K_w) and white layer thickness(WLT) are measured as responses.PCA is used as multi-response optimization technique to derive the composite principal component(CPC) which acts as the overall quality index in the process.Consequently, Taguchi's S/N ratio analysis is applied to optimize the CPC. The derived optimal process responses are confirmed by the experimental validation tests results.The analysis of variance is conducted to find the effects of choosing process variables on the overall quality of the machined component. 2Modeling and multi-response optimization of machining performance while turning hardened steel with self-propelled rotary tool显示文摘There are many advanced tooling approaches in metal cutting to enhance the cutting tool performance for machining hard-to-cut materials.The self propelled rotary tool(SPRT) is one of the novel approaches to improve the cutting tool performance by providing cutting edge in the form of a disk,which rotates about its principal axis and provides a rest period for the cutting edge to cool and allow engaging a fresh cutting edge with the work piece.This paper aimed to present the cutting performance of SPRT while turning hardened EN24 steel and optimize the machining conditions.Surface roughness(R_a) and metal removal rate(r_(MMR)) are considered as machining performance parameters to evaluate,while the horizontal inclination angle of the SPRT,depth of cut,feed rate and spindle speed are considered as process variables.Initially,design of experiments(DOEs) is employed to minimize the number of experiments.For each set of chosen process variables,the machining experiments are conducted on computer numerical control(CNC) lathe to measure the machining responses.Then,the response surface methodology(RSM) is used to establish quantitative relationships for the output responses in terms of the input variables.Analysis of variance(ANOVA) is used to check the adequacy of the model.The influence of input variables on the output responses is also determined.Consequently,these models are formulated as a multi-response optimization problem to minimize the R_a and maximize the r_(MMR)simultaneously.Non-dominated sorting genetic algorithmII(NSGA-II) is used to derive the set of Pareto-optimal solutions.The optimal results obtained through the proposed methodology are also compared with the results of validation experimental runs and good correlation is found between them.Thella Babu Rao A.Gopala Krishna Ramesh Kumar Katta Konjeti Rama Krishna 2015Advances in Manufacturing2015,3,1:2
